In the heart of the Xinjiang region, China, the Yingbazar Hydrological Monitoring Station plays a vital role in the country's water management and flood prevention efforts. Established in the 1950s, it is one of the oldest and most important stations in the region, responsible for monitoring water levels, flows, and quality in the nearby river systems. Here, we explore the significance of hydrological monitoring at the Yingbazar Hydrological Monitoring Station and its impact on water resources management in China.

The first and foremost role of the Yingbazar Hydrological Monitoring Station is to measure and record water levels and flows in the river systems it monitors. These data are crucial for water management, as they provide information on the amount of water available, its quality, and any potential changes in the river's behavior. For example, if a river's flow suddenly increases or decreases, this could indicate a shift in the water balance, potentially leading to flooding or drought. By monitoring these changes, the station can issue warnings and help prevent such disasters.

Furthermore, the data collected by the station are also essential for flood prevention and management. Xinjiang, where the station is located, experiences occasional flooding, which can cause significant damage to property and crops. However, by monitoring water levels and flows, the station can predict these events and provide timely warnings to nearby communities. Additionally, the station works closely with local governments and disaster management agencies to ensure a coordinated response in case of an emergency.

Another challenge is the varying weather conditions in Xinjiang, which can affect water levels and flows. For example, during the summer months, when temperatures are high, evaporation rates increase, leading to lower water levels in rivers. Conversely, during the winter months, when temperatures drop significantly, rivers may freeze, affecting flow rates. The station needs to take into account these seasonal variations to provide accurate data.
